On the basis of melting point, differentiate between metals and non-metals .

The atoms in metals are closely packed. So, they need more energy to move them apart and convert them into liquid. So metals, in general, have high melting and boiling point while non-metals are held by weak intermolecular force of attraction, so less heat required to break them. As a result, they have low melting and boiling points.
